Skyline already looking forward to next season after loss in district semifinal

By AnnArbor.com Staff

Skyline ended its season with a 3-0 loss to Brighton (25-17, 25-15, 25-12) in the semifinals of the Class A District tournament, but the Eagles have a lot of hope for the future of their volleyball program.

The Eagles' set a goal this year to have a .500 winning percentage, and they accomplished that with a record of 22-22-7. It is one of the more successful seasons of competition for the many new varsity teams at Skyline.

Understandably, Hinz is excited to see what her team can do next season when all her juniors turn into seniors.

"The good part for us is that no one is graduating. Everyone will be back," said Hinz. "You don't know what to expect, but it feels really good to know they'll be back, it's Pretty exciting looking forward."
